Gambusia puncticulata Poey, 1854 Caribbean gambusia |

| Family: | Poeciliidae (Poeciliids), subfamily: Poeciliinae | |||
| Max. size: | 3.58 cm SL (male/unsexed); 5.47 cm SL (female) | |||
| Environment: | benthopelagic; freshwater; brackish, non-migratory | |||
| Distribution: | Central America: throughout Cuba, Jamaica, Cayman Islands and Bahamas. | |||
| Diagnosis: | ||||
| Biology: | Found in fresh, brackish and salt waters in coastal and lowland areas. | |||
| IUCN Red List Status: | Least Concern (LC); Date assessed: 27 April 2020 Ref. (130435) | |||
| Threat to humans: | harmless | |||
